  • HILO, Hawaii – Waves hammered the shore of Keaukaha on Wednesday as the passing Tropical Storm Guillermo churned the Pacific to the northeast of the Big Island. The Tropical Storm Watch for Hawaii Island has been cancelled, but a High Surf Warning remains in effect for east facing shores. The footage above was shot at the closed Onekahakaha Beach Park around 9 a.m.
  • The following beach parks in Hilo are closed today due to hazardous conditions:

  • Onekahakaha Beach Park
  • Kealoha Beach Park
  • Leileiwi Beach Park
  • Richardsons Beach Park
